Sherri Jones to head up historical society
09.06.10 The Coastal Georgia Historical Society announces the appointment of Sherri Jones as its new executive director, effective immediately. She succeeds Patricia Morris, who served as executive director from 2001 to 2010. Jones has been a member of the board of directors since 2009, where she successfully launched the first annual event celebrating a higher category of membership called “Keepers of the Light.” An active volunteer in Brunswick and the Golden Isles, Jones currently serves as president of the Golden Isles Arts and Humanities Association and is secretary and a member of the executive committee of the St. Simons Land Trust.

5th Annual Shrimp & Grits festival kicks off Sept. 17
09.06.10 On Friday, September 17 Jekyll Island will kickoff the 5th Annual Shrimp and Grits festival featuring this quintessential Southern dish and spotlighting Wild Georgia Shrimp. Held in Jekyll's Historic District, the festival features amateur and professional cooking competitions, shrimp boat excursions, shrimp eating contests, cooking demonstrations, races, and entertainment. In honor of this popular Southern dish, September has officially been declared “Wild Georgia Shrimp Month” on Jekyll Island and the neighboring Golden Isles. Friday night is $3 Shrimp Sample Night. Beginning at 5:30 p.m. participants will have the opportunity to taste recipes from the vendors for $3 per sample.
